Proposed One-month Detention for Six People arrested in the ‘Abstergo’ Operation

Published January 28, 2026
Share
SHARE

Acting prosecutors of the Sarajevo Canton Prosecutor’s Office proposed to the Sarajevo Municipal Court that the suspects Kemo Zilić, Adil Mulić, Esad Zajka, Zehrid Hasanović, Mustafa Balaš and Fendi Zuka, who were arrested in the “Abstergo” operation, be detained for one month.

Their detention was proposed due to the danger that the suspects could influence witnesses, hide evidence, obstruct the criminal proceedings and repeat the crime if they were at liberty.

For eight suspects who are under investigation by the Prosecutor’s Office in that case, more precisely, for seven members of the examination commission and the owner of the driving school, the prosecutors proposed prohibitive measures. And that is a ban on performing tasks related to taking driving tests in all authorities on the territory of BiH, a ban on mutual contact and meetings, and a ban on the same with witnesses, according to a statement from the Canton Sarajevo Prosecutor’s Office.

Police officers of the Police Department of the MoI of Sarajevo Canton, under the supervision of acting KS prosecutors, implemented the “Abstergo” operation, with the aim of documenting criminal acts of abuse of position or authority and receiving gifts and other forms of benefit.
